Cracked Screen Replacement

Chromebook screens are notoriously thin. Whether it took a tumble in a backpack at QUT or met the floor at home, we stock a wide range of replacement panels for Acer, HP, ASUS, and Lenovo models. We can often swap them out the same day.

Battery & Power Jack Repair

If your Chromebook only works when it’s plugged in, or the USB-C port feels loose, it’s a hardware issue we see every day. We don’t just replace parts; we ensure your charging circuit is drawing the right voltage so you don’t fry your motherboard.

Keyboard and trackpad issues

Sticky keys, missing keys, unresponsive typing, and trackpad problems can make a Chromebook frustrating to use. These issues are often repairable without replacing the whole device.

The “ChromeOS is Missing or Damaged” Error

Software glitches can be just as frustrating as a broken hinge. If your device is stuck in a boot loop or showing the dreaded "White Screen of Death," our technicians can reflash your firmware and recover your local files faster than a factory reset.

Slow performance, freezing, and startup issues

If your Chromebook has become sluggish, keeps restarting, or gets stuck during startup, we can check both hardware and ChromeOS-related causes.

Liquid damage and accidental spills

Spills happen. Quick action matters here. The sooner a Chromebook is checked, the better the chance of saving the device and the data on it.
